OSU Men’s Gymnastics Hires Blaine Wilson as Assistant Coach

Posted on 16 July 2009 by admin

Three-time U.S.A. Gymnastics Olympian, Blaine Wilson, was hired on as an assistant coach by Ohio State Head Coach Miles Avery.  Wilson, a former Buckeye, won a silver team medal at the 2004 Olympics, and was also on the Olympic team in 1996 and 2000.  He was the U.S. all-around champion an incredible five years in a row (1996-2000).
